Our current podcast series hosted by Veronica D'Souza, “What Shapes”, is a new, short-form podcast series exploring the human side of creativity through intimate conversations with influential voices from our community. Each episode delves into the ideas, experiences, and values that inform creative lives within design, architecture, art and culture. From identity and beauty to responsibility, memory, and the future. Recorded during 3daysofdesign 2026, the series marks the beginning of an on ongoing dialogue designed to uncover the untold stories behind creative practice.

Tune into our first episode featuring Lee Broom, a leading product designer in the UK. Since founding his studio in 2007 Lee Broom has created over 100 lighting, furniture and accessories, all designed by Lee himself and retailed around the world. Combining craft, materiality and innovation, the products are Made in Britain by hand at the Lee Broom factory in East London. Exhibiting collections globally, Lee Broom has gained a reputation for creating conceptual dynamic installations which are surreal, experiential and unexpected. This conversation was recorded live during 3daysofdesign 2025.
